fix: Historical packets now load on initial page load for all users
- Fixed issue where historical packets were only loaded when tracking a specific callsign - Changed needs_initial_historical_load to always be true on mount - Added comprehensive test suite for historical packet loading scenarios - Tests verify loading with/without tracked callsign, custom time ranges, and zoom-based limits - Ensures users see recent activity immediately when visiting the map Also fixed JavaScript error about enabledFeatures being undefined - this was from a browser extension, not the application code. 🤖 Generated with [Claude Code](https://claude.ai/code) Co-Authored-By: Claude <noreply@anthropic.com>

## Key Technical Details
|
||||
|
||||
### Parser Field Mappings
|
||||
The enhanced parser now provides these additional fields that are mapped to database columns:
|
||||
- `posambiguity` → position_ambiguity (0-4 level indicator)
|
||||
- `wx` → dedicated weather data field (prioritized over other weather fields)
|
||||
- `radiorange` → RNG field from comments (e.g., "RNG0050")
|
||||
- PHG data now comes as string "1060" instead of map structure
|
||||
|
||||
### Backward Compatibility
|
||||
All changes maintain backward compatibility:
|
||||
- Weather extraction checks multiple field locations (wx, weather, weather_report, raw_weather_data)
|
||||
- PHG parsing handles both string and map formats
|
||||
- Standard fields are extracted from top-level attributes if present
